The Science of Materials: Why American Formulas Outperform
Brake pad performance hinges on the materials used. Most pads fall into three categories: ceramic, semi-metallic, and low-metallic NAO (non-asbestos organic). American manufacturers excel in formulating these materials to balance performance, longevity, and comfort. Here’s how they stack up:
1. Ceramic Brake Pads
Ceramic pads are favored for their quiet operation, low dust production, and ability to handle high temperatures. American brands like Akebono (headquartered in California) and Hawk Performance (based in Tennessee) use advanced ceramic composites blended with copper fibers or other metals to enhance thermal conductivity. This means they dissipate heat faster than cheaper ceramic alternatives, reducing the risk of brake fade during prolonged stops (e.g., mountain driving or towing). In independent tests, American-made ceramic pads showed 20–30% less wear on brake rotors compared to imported ceramic pads after 10,000 miles—a critical factor in extending the life of your braking system.
2. Semi-Metallic Brake Pads
Semi-metallic pads (made with 30–70% metal, typically iron, copper, or steel) are prized for their superior heat transfer and stopping power. American manufacturers like Wagner (a division of Federal-Mogul, based in Michigan) engineer these pads with precise metal-to-filler ratios to avoid common pitfalls: too much metal causes noise and rotor wear; too little reduces bite. Their proprietary blends, such as Wagner’s ThermoQuiet, use corrosion-resistant metals and friction modifiers that maintain consistent performance even in wet or dusty conditions. Real-world data from trucking fleets using Wagner pads shows a 15% reduction in brake-related maintenance costs over five years compared to fleets using lower-cost imported semi-metallic pads.
3. Low-Metallic NAO Brake Pads
Low-metallic NAO pads (made with less than 30% metal, combined with organic fibers and fillers) are a budget-friendly option that still delivers reliable performance. American brands like Bendix (owned by Honeywell, with U.S. manufacturing facilities in Kentucky) formulate these pads to minimize noise and dust while providing enough bite for daily driving. Unlike some imported NAO pads, which rely on cheap fillers (like clay) that degrade quickly, American versions use high-quality organic resins and aramid fibers (similar to Kevlar) to enhance durability. In tests, Bendix’s NAO pads showed 25% longer rotor life than imported counterparts, making them a smart middle ground for cost-conscious drivers.

Buying American-Made Brake Pads: What to Look For
Now that you know why American-made pads are worth the investment, how do you ensure you’re getting the real deal? Here’s a step-by-step guide:
1. Check the “Made in USA” Label
Not all “American” brands manufacture in the U.S. Some import components from overseas and assemble them domestically, which doesn’t guarantee the same quality. Look for products with a clear “Made in USA” sticker or label, and verify the manufacturer’s address (e.g., “Manufactured in Detroit, MI”).
2. Research the Brand’s Manufacturing Facilities
Reputable American brands proudly share details about their production facilities. For example, Akebono’s website lists its U.S. plants in South Carolina and Kentucky, complete with photos and compliance certifications. If a brand is vague about where its pads are made, consider it a red flag.
3. Look for Certifications
Certifications like SAE J2784 (thermal performance) or NSF/ANSI 11 (for non-metallic materials) indicate that a product has been independently verified for quality. Avoid pads that lack these certifications, as they may not meet industry standards.
